awful lot of cough syrup in twenty twenty-five: the snapshot
awful lot of cough syrup (alocs) starts 2025 maintaining the consistent limited-release blueprint: visual-centric tees and heavyweight sweatshirts, quick sellouts, with a buzz loop driven by Instagram reveals with pop-up drops. Look for bold, defiant imagery, oversized proportions, and tight stock that favors people who follow releases closely. Their brand’s base remains younger shoppers and early users who desire counter-culture energy for accessible streetwear price ranges.
The label—also known as awful lot of cough syrup, thats A awful lot Of cough syrup, plus simply cough syrup—sits inside the lane with brands like Corteiz, Trapstar, and Sp5der, but it pushes darker wit and nostalgia-heavy graphics. Many releases center on basic staples like boxy tops, pullover and zip hoodies, trucker caps, with the occasional cargo plus accessory run. Limited supply is part of this aesthetic, so learning the drop rhythm, knowing the way the pieces fit, and running a clean legitimacy check are table basics in 2025.

Pricing guide: what alocs items cost in 2025
Look for tops in their middle two-digit range and hoodies in the lower-to-center hundreds at retail, with extras placed lower and bottoms marginally higher. Cost changes with fabric thickness, premium printing like puff plus high-density, stitched elements, and when it’s a typical basic image or a collab drop. Duties, taxes, plus shipping introduce real variation across locations.
Latest drops and verified sales show t-shirts commonly range about 45–75 US dollars based on thickness with printing technique. Pullover plus zip sweatshirts usually land around 95–180 USD, rising with thicker fleece plus layered prints. Cargo pants or track pants trend between 120–200 USD, while baseball hats and beanies land approximately in the thirty to sixty-five USD bracket. Add-ons like keychains, decals, and compact goods typically range between lower range USD. Secondary market premiums hinge on the design and sizing; small and extra large plus occasionally demand more, shaped by manufacturing mix plus interest.

Legit check toolkit: labels, stitching, and prints
Authentic alocs shows even tag fonts, clean construction, and print methods which don’t bleed, bubble, plus smudge. Fakes usually miss on typography spacing, ink application, and garment cut, even when the design looks close in poor quality photos. Always request natural light shots of neck marking, wash label, inside construction, and macro images showing the print edge.
Collar labels on genuine items employ crisp fonts with uniform spacing; characters don’t wander, and this alignment is straight. Cleaning instructions show material content and maintenance with proper formatting and gaps; mistakes or poor grammar are warning signs. Ink design borders on real pieces appear sharp under magnification: no bleeding into this fabric, and solid areas don’t display scattered pinholes. Textured printing elevates consistently approximately 1–2 millimeters showing even rising; inferior replicas rise unevenly and feel synthetic. Sewing becomes one deciding factor: balanced edge construction and a sharp inner completion indicate a quality construction.
| Component | Authentic alocs | Common Fake Tells |
|---|---|---|
| Neck tag typography | Clear letters, even alignment, centered placement | Wavy baseline, uneven spacing, crooked sew |
| Wash label content | Clear fabric/care, standard symbols, correct grammar | Strange phrasing, missing symbols, low-res print |
| Puff print edge | Uniform, uniform rise, sharp edge at edge | Irregular, inconsistent height, bleed onto fabric |
| Screen fill/halftone | Dense fill, clean halftone dots under zoom | Uneven fill, muddied halftone, streaking |
| Stitching quality | Aligned seams, tidy coverstitch, minimal loose ends | Crooked seams, loose threads, poor tension |
| Garment block | Square tee, roomy hoodie featuring balanced length | Tight tee, short sleeves, hood too small and floppy |
| Seller proof | Sales receipt, high-res tag/print pictures in daylight | No receipt, stock photos alone, refusal to provide labels |

Care and wash in order to keep prints alive
Clean cold, turn inside inside out, and hang dry to maintain textured with screen graphics on alocs garments. Temperature is a threat to ink integrity, so skip machine-dry hot and avoid strong detergents or whitening agents. Careful treatment maintains pigment intensity with avoids early deterioration.
Raised graphics perform well through a mild-movement wash with hang-dry process; the finish stays uniform rather versus crushing. Basic screen prints tolerate more stress however still survive longer through inside-out cleaning and minimal fabric treatment. If one requires tumble-drying, choose one coolest setting and briefest duration, then end horizontal. Store pullover tops folded versus suspended to avoid distorting the shoulders and to preserve the hood shape. Treat stains where practical instead of completing any full cycle after every light wearing.
